Food and Nutrition for Helpless Cows

Daily Feeding Saves Lives (Warm Hearts for Voiceless Lives)

Food is one of the most basic needs of every living being. Many cows wandering on roads do not get proper fodder, green grass, grains, or clean water. Some are forced to eat waste, plastic, or spoiled food, which can harm their health.

Proper nutrition helps cows stay strong, recover from illness, and live with dignity. Regular feeding also prevents weakness and improves their overall health. For injured or old cows, nutritious food becomes even more important because their bodies need strength to heal.

Medical Care and Treatment

Healing Pain Through Timely Support (Warm Hearts for Voiceless Lives)

Injured cows need timely medical care. Road accidents, wounds, infections, fractures, and weakness can become serious if not treated quickly. Many cows suffer for days because nobody comes forward to help them.

Medical treatment includes wound cleaning, dressing, medicines, injections, check-ups, and proper rest. Regular care can help injured cows recover and return to a safer condition. For disabled or old cows, medical attention gives relief from pain and improves their quality of life.

Safe Shelter and Protection (Warm Hearts for Voiceless Lives)

  • Protection from Road Accidents: Safe shelter keeps abandoned and injured cows away from busy roads, vehicles, and unsafe public places.
  • Safety from Harsh Weather: A proper shelter protects cows from extreme heat, heavy rain, cold winds, and direct sunlight.
  • Peaceful Resting Space: Injured, old, and weak cows need a calm place where they can rest comfortably and recover without fear.
  • Clean and Hygienic Environment: A clean shelter helps prevent infections, skin problems, and diseases among cows.
  • Regular Food and Water Access: Sheltered cows can receive fresh fodder, clean drinking water, and proper nutrition every day.

Caring for Old and Disabled Cows

They Need Extra Love and Attention

Old and disabled cows need special care. Some cannot walk properly. Some have weak eyesight. Some are too old to search for food or protect themselves. Without support, these cows may suffer more than healthy animals.

Caring for old and disabled cows requires patience, time, and regular attention. They need soft food, clean water, medical check-ups, safe resting areas, and emotional care. These cows may not be productive in a material sense, but their lives are still valuable.
